Background technology
In vehicular field, become more and more general as the alternative to general internal combustion engine using alternative energy source Time.Specifically, electric vehicle has become extremely promising scheme.
Electric vehicle can be promoted individually using motor or be promoted using the device including both motor and internal combustion engine. Latter type is referred to as hybrid vehicle (HEV), and can use as follows, i.e., is used when driving except urban district interior Combustion engine operates vehicle, and in urban district or in the ring for needing the limitation noxious pollutants such as carbon monoxide and nitrogen oxides discharge Motor is used in border.In addition, hybrid vehicle uses the electric energy with the rechargeable battery for providing electric power to motor to deposit Storage system.
In the presence of the other types of vehicle that can be operated using traction units such as motors, for example, tramcar and row (it is not usually for vehicle (that is, the railroad vehicle run in track on being layed in ground) and bus and haulage vehicle Rail).Such vehicle can be powered by aerial current conductor, that is, power contacts electric wire, the aerial current conductor formed to A part for the external power supply of motor supply electric power in vehicle.For this reason, the vehicle is provided with current collector, all Such as pantograph, it is located on the roof of vehicle and is configured for contacting with the current conductor during operation.At this In the vehicle of a little types, it is not usually required to any rechargeable battery, because continuously to motor during the operation of vehicle Power supply.
In short, the vehicle with motor, --- vehicle or hybrid vehicle that motor is used alone --- is needed from outside Power supply supplies electric power.Electric power is used to energy storage system charge or for directly promoting vehicle.In addition, external power supply can In the form of common grid power system, it can be accessed via (for example) conventional aerial current conductor (as mentioned above).Alternative Ground, external power supply can be the separate unit of the power supply particularly suitable as vehicle.
External power supply provides electric power to onboard electric systems, and the purposes of the onboard electric systems is the certain of control vehicle Electric function, especially for the operation of control motor.
For the vehicle of the electric device with mentioned kind, monitor that the electrical isolation resistance of onboard electric systems is very heavy It wants.More specifically, it is necessary to monitor and carefully analyze the insulation resistance between (for example) two aerial conductors.Insulation resistance is supervised Depending on general purpose be to provide control function, indicate the state of the electric system of vehicle, meet specification in particular for control And any trouble unit that may be needed replacing for identification.For example, the electricity caused by inappropriate insulation or ground connection is absolutely Edge resistance can not cause parts damages completely and can also become security risk.
In the situation for the vehicle that is related to there is motor and be powered by external power supply, it is generally necessary to monitor onboard electric It the system i.e. insulation resistance of the first power network and is connected to exhausted between current collector i.e. the second power network of the external power supply Both edge resistance.Previously known use and the associated insulation resistance monitoring unit of the first power network and related with the second power network Another insulation resistance monitoring unit of connection monitors the insulation resistance of electric system.It is used for two different power network different exhausted The fact that edge resistance monitoring unit be based on in the case where multiple monitoring units are connected to same power network its may do Disturb seeing clearly for mutual measured value.
For this reason, previous schemes are to use trunking, are configured to connect in multiple monitored power network A monitoring unit is physically disconnected in the case of together.However, this will lead to additional components and fringe cost.In addition, It may cause about whether the uncertainty for really closing specific insulation monitoring disconnection repeater.If it is not, may nothing Method accurately detects potential insulation fault.
Based on disadvantages mentioned above, problem associated with the prior art is to reduce the quantity of necessary insulating detection equipment, from And reduce the cost and complexity of such system.
In addition, patent document JP 2012-223020 teach a kind of system for monitoring the electrical isolation resistance in vehicle, It has contactor between vehicle and the pantograph for being connectable to external power supply.In addition, electrical isolation detection device can connect It is connected to pantograph.However, even if JP 2012-223020 are directed to insulation resistance monitoring field, but be still required to using few Amount insulation monitoring unit monitor insulation resistance in several power network and still provide accurately monitor by improved method and be System.

With reference to Fig. 2 embodiments of the present invention will be described in more detail, Fig. 2 be include above-mentioned motor 2, electric system 3, collection It flows device 7,8 and is provided for monitoring the peace of the device 9 of certain other components of the electrical isolation resistance in the electric system 3 Row.
As explained above, external power supply 4 is provided with the first conductor 5 and the second conductor 6, is constituted according to embodiment for having There is the conductor of the voltage of magnitude 600V.First current collector 7 is connected to the first input of electric system 3 via the first main contactor 10 Terminal, and the second current collector 8 is connected to the second input terminal of electric system 3 via the second main contactor 11.Main contactor 10, Each of 11 constitute the high current repeater containing controllable switch.Both contactors 10,11 are connected to control unit 12, It is configured to control the situation each switched.
According to embodiment, precharge unit 13 is connected in parallel with the second main contactor 11.The purposes of precharge unit 13 is Originate the start-up mode of electric system 3 immediately when current collector 7,8 is connected to conductor 5,6.During this start-up mode, to coming Current limit is carried out from the supply electric power of external power supply 4 so that when obtaining controlled rising of the input voltage during the starting stage Between be very important.Do not have such " precharge ", the high voltage that bridging tentaculum 10,11 applies can cause that contactor can be damaged 10,11 and electric system 3 component electric arc.Thus, the purposes of precharge unit 13 is limited during above-mentioned power up phase Inrush current.
In order to activate precharge unit 13 comprising connect with the precharge with controllable switch that resistor 15 is connected in series with Tentaculum 14.Pre-charge contactor 14 is connected to control unit 12 according to two above-mentioned contactors 10,11 similar modes.
In addition, control unit 12 includes insulation resistance monitoring unit 16.Control unit 12 is connected to chassis earth point, but this It is not shown.As initially referred to, pair monitored with onboard electric systems 3 and pantograph 7,8 associated insulation resistances It is important.For this reason, insulation resistance monitoring unit 16 carries out being configured to ensure that two pantographs 7,8 in some way Being electrically insulated between ground, as an alternative between the input terminal of electric system 3 and ground is sufficiently high.This utilizes insulation resistance Monitoring unit 16 realizes that the insulation resistance monitoring unit 16 is configured for measuring insulation resistance.In practice, this is meaned Insulation resistance should be as close possible to infinity.Pass through this monitoring of insulation resistance, it may be determined that electric system 3 or pantograph 7, whether 8 contain any defective FRU, inappropriate electrical isolation, carelessness ground connection or short circuit or similar electric defect.Insulation resistance is supervised It can be configured to initiate burst emergency signals in the case where the insulation resistance detected is less than predetermined threshold depending on unit 16.
Insulation resistance monitoring unit 16 is associated with control unit 12, and in the connection of pantograph 7,8 and conductor 5,6 and During disconnection, control unit 12 is configured to disconnect and be closed to form the first main contactor 10, the second main contactor 11 and preliminary filling The switch of the part of electric unit 13.For this purpose, control unit 12 is additionally configured to the position of control pantograph 7,8, That is, in some way so that it may be electrically connected to conductor 5,6 and is disconnected from conductor 5,6.It should be noted that Fig. 2 shows pantographs 7,8 it is under the situation that conductor 5,6 disconnects.Control unit 12 is utilized to carry out for controlling according to the particular order that will now be described Pantograph 7,8 processed is connected and disconnected from situation and is additionally operable to the first main contactor 10 of control, the second main contactor 11 and preliminary filling The process of electric unit 13.
As indicated in figure 2, make from the first conductor 5 and the second conductor 6 supply electric power via the first current collector 7 and warp By the second current collector 8 to electric system 3 into line feed.The current collector 7,8 being made of pantograph according to embodiment is respectively via One main contactor 10 and the second main contactor 11 are connected to electric system 3.Fig. 2 shows current collectors 7,8 to disconnect from two conductors 5,6 Situation.Under this situation, the first main contactor 10 and the second main contactor 11 are under its closed condition, and monitor electricity Force system 3 includes the insulation resistance of current collector 7,8.Embodiment according to fig. 2 is also closed pre-charge contactor 14.As long as main Contactor 10,11 is maintained under its closed condition, supports the monitoring of the insulation resistance of electric system 3.
When it is desirable that electric system 3 is connected to external power supply, main contactor 10,11 is arranged under its disconnection situation. This is shown in FIG. 3, and Fig. 3 is also shown pre-charge contactor 14 and is arranged under its disconnection situation.Next step is shown in Fig. 4 That is current collector 7,8 is then controlled to be connected to corresponding conductor 5,6 by using control unit 12, at the same contactor 10,11, 14 are maintained under its disconnection situation.
Then, embodiment according to figure 5, pre-charge contactor 14 and the first main contactor 10 are closed together, from And pre-charging stage is originated, as described above, the pre-charging stage is expected the electric power that limitation is supplied from external power supply 4 so that The controlled rise time of input voltage is obtained during pre-charging stage.More precisely, the closure of pre-charge contactor 14 will be electric Resistance device 15 is connected in parallel with the second main contactor 11.
Next step is shown, wherein be closed the second main contactor 11, this terminates pre-charging stage and by conductor in Fig. 6 5, both 6 onboard electric systems 3 are connected to.Under this situation, there is also to insulation resistance during the operation of electric system 3 Monitoring.
Electric system 3 is disconnected from external power supply 4 with opposite way implementation.First, by main contactor 10,11 and precharge Contactor 14 is arranged under its disconnection situation.Next, current collector 7,8 is disconnected from conductor 5,6.Finally, by main contactor 10, 11 and pre-charge contactor 14 be arranged under its closed condition to monitor electrical isolation resistance.
Fig. 7 is the flow chart for showing program according to an embodiment of the invention.Initially, system is in external power supply 4 and does not connect It is connected under the situation of onboard electric systems 3 and (is designated as in the figure 7 " step 17 ").This operating conditions corresponds to the disclosure of Fig. 2 Content, that is, the insulation resistance of monitoring electric system 3.
Next, (step 18) is arranged under its disconnection situation as connecting electric system 3 in main contactor 10,11 It is connected to the preparation of external power supply 4.In the embodiment that device 9 includes precharge unit 13, also by preliminary filling during this stage Electric contactor 14 is arranged under its disconnection situation (step 18a).
Next, the first current collector 7 and the second current collector 8 are connected respectively to 6 (step of the first conductor 5 and the second conductor 19).This is executed while maintaining contactor 10,11,14 in its open position.
The next step of the process is to be closed 10 (step 20) of the first main contactor.Optionally, including precharge In the embodiment of unit 13, it is also closed pre-charge contactor 14 (step 19a), is hereafter closed the second main contactor 11.With this side Formula obtains during electric system 3 and the operation of vehicle 1 and continues monitoring (step 21) to insulation resistance.
Current collector 7,8 is disconnected from external power supply 4 with opposite way implementation, as explained above.
